sana24 Med Call or Tel Doc — Region 2, Ticino
Region 2, Ticino: with sana24, sana24 Med Call costs CHF 693.70 a month in 2026 and Tel Doc CHF 658.70, for an adult with a CHF 300 deductible and accident cover. The table below gives the gap at every deductible.
Tel Doc is the cheaper of the two here: CHF 420.00 saved per year against sana24 Med Call, for cover identical under the law. What you pay more or less for is the care pathway.
What you accept in each case
sana24 Med Call and Tel Doc are both "Telemedicine and others" models. The exact conditions still differ from one product to the other: ask the insurer before signing.

The price at every deductible
| Deductible | sana24 Med Call | Tel Doc | Gap per year |
|---|---|---|---|
| 300 | CHF 693.70 | CHF 658.70 | CHF 420.00 |
| 500 | CHF 682.00 | CHF 647.00 | CHF 420.00 |
| 1'000 | CHF 652.90 | CHF 617.80 | CHF 421.20 |
| 1'500 | CHF 623.70 | CHF 588.70 | CHF 420.00 |
| 2'000 | CHF 594.50 | CHF 559.50 | CHF 420.00 |
| 2'500 | CHF 565.40 | CHF 530.30 | CHF 421.20 |
